Output 89fe68b773264e1db355ebd2dcb30d2d0f7bf2f311daa5e6edd367ec83930927:1

value
124547784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e7a7dfedb048f29278fff2249ef4184b662024 OP_EQUAL
address
MAAqxkwzbH39KGeHbHCiqAti1ZAATYM66L
transaction
89fe68b773264e1db355ebd2dcb30d2d0f7bf2f311daa5e6edd367ec83930927
spent
true